How much does a senior electrical engineer earn in Encinitas, CA?

The average senior electrical engineer in Encinitas, CA earns between $88,000 and $160,000 annually. This compares to the national average senior electrical engineer range of $82,000 to $144,000.

Average senior electrical engineer salary in Encinitas, CA

$119,000
